Backing up hidden folders in c:\users via NAS backup jobs is tricky, there are files in there that are locked down (and others that usually open).
If you have another PC, you can try copying AppData to a temp directory on it as a test.

I have done the update to the beta software, but still the same problem. I have deleted the backups and re-initiated them again. Just indexing is being performed. For some of them after re-initiating they say that the backup is complete with a green checkmark, however, no files are in the backup folder.
If I create a new backup with a folder I have not backed up before it works, until I remove the backup and then reinitiate. Then I have the same problem again. Either indexing forever, or no files in the folder in spite of a green check-mark for a completed backup.
There seem to be some serious bugs in the backup function in the Readycloud App, so I will for now use the Memeo Backup software for these backups.
